I can't see doing it without at least jacking the rear end up and putting it on stands. I have been able to empty the tank with one of those $5 bulb siphons from Home Despot, then unhooking the fuel line at the FI and running the pump to get the rest of it out. Don't take the strainer out with gas in the tank!
I am all in favor or doing stuff yourself, but this is an excellent job to outsource to someone with a gas caddy, a lift, and disposal facilities. To say nothing of the giant hex key you need to unscrew the strainer assembly. It's not all that rewarding as a learning experience and you will stink up your garage for a week. Gas fumes seem to linger in concrete floors.
